PROGRAMS AIMED TO HELP STUDENTS

Canada Emergency Student Benefit (CESB)

CESB provides support to students and new graduates who are not eligible for the CERB or Employment Insurance or otherwise unable to work due to COVID-19. This benefit provides $1,250 per month for eligible students or $1,750 per month for eligible students with disabilities or dependants. To learn more, click here.

Canada Student Service Grant (CSSG)

Our Government will help young people gain valuable experience and skills while they help their communities during the COVID-19 pandemic. The grant is for students who choose to engage in services that aid their communities. The new CSSG will provide up to $5,000 for their education in the fall. Please Note: For all student loan borrowers, the repayment of loans and applicable interest will be suspended until September 30, 2020. To learn more, click here.
